Poem-A-Day April 6: fireflies

Myth

Each tree is in love
with one star.

Their tears come to life
as fireflies.

We sometimes feel them
burning our eyes.


Today’s poem by Ata Moharreri can be found in the lovely anthology Poetry Is Not A Luxury: Poems for All Seasons (2025), a collection assembled by @poetryisnotaluxury.
